Misclassification of Employees in California: Laws, Penalties, & Reporting

Being classified correctly at work isn’t just a formality - it’s the difference between having the rights and protections you deserve or being denied basic benefits. Unfortunately, employee misclassification is more common than many realize, especially in industries like construction, delivery services, hospitality, and gig work. If you’ve been treated as an independent contractor when you should legally be an employee, you could be missing out on critical protections like minimum wage, overtime pay, meal and rest breaks, workers’ compensation, unemployment insurance, and more.
